Chess We Can: MRH Youth Take First Place at Tournament
Maplewood Richmond Heights Elementary School topped 10 other teams to win the Gateway Chess League Fall Open in November.
The chess team at took first place Nov. 19 in its first tournament of the year.
The win at the Gateway Chess League Fall Open placed the MRH team atop 10 other teams in the 6th Grade and Under Division, a news release from the MRH School District states. The team's trophy has been placed in the elementary school library.
Fourth-grader Josh Goldberg received a medal for the total number of points he earned.
In addition to Josh, the tournament team featured:
- Salem Bussey
- Gabe Leavy
- Mason Kramer
- Malik Stewart
- Freeman Reinhold
Ben Simon began coaching the team in 2006 as a college freshman.
“In chess, never judge the playing strength of your opponent by what he
looks like,” Simon stated in the release. “If you do, that 5-year-old is going to
embarrass you.”
The tournament happened at Washington Middle School in Washington, MO.
